  • Clear Dumpster Size Guidance

    We focus on giving straightforward advice on choosing the right dumpster size for your project, avoiding unnecessary costs or multiple hauls.

    Real World Example:

    For a mid-sized home renovation, we recommend a 20-yard dumpster to fit debris efficiently without overcrowding.

  • Transparent Rules on Prohibited Items

    We explain exactly what materials you can't toss in a dumpster to keep your rental compliant with local regulations and avoid fines.

    Real World Example:

    Flammable liquids and hazardous chemicals are off-limits, so we guide you on proper disposal alternatives.

  • Practical Tips on Dumpster Placement

    Our guides include advice on positioning dumpsters to protect driveways and respect neighbors while maximizing access for our trucks.

    Real World Example:

    We suggest placing dumpsters on flat concrete areas and using plywood sheets to prevent driveway damage.

  • Insights on Rental Duration and Overages

    We break down how rental timing works and what happens if you need more time or space, so you can plan and budget confidently.

    Real World Example:

    Extending your rental by a few days is possible, but it's better to anticipate your project’s pace upfront.

If you’re sorting through guides for a roof tear-off, garage cleanout, or concrete pile, start with the job itself, not the container you wish would fit. Our small project sizing, medium project sizing, and large project sizing pages make that part easier. We also keep a close eye on heavy loads with heavy debris sizing, because rock, brick, and slab behave different than household junk.
